Manchester United will host Arsenal at Old Trafford on Thursday evening, as the Reds look to build on an impressive first week for caretaker boss Michael Carrick.
Since the departure of Ole Gunnar Solskjaer just last week, the Red Devils have since ensured qualification the last 16 of the Champions League and picked up a point away at league leaders Chelsea in the space of just six days.
Now, with the arrival of interim boss Ralf Rangnick imminent, Carrick will take charge of the side against the Gunners hoping to record his first victory in the Premier League, with a win lifting United as high as sixth, should results go their way.
